I always thought open adoption was a scam until my daughter's mom proved me wrong

I was 19 when I placed my baby for adoption, and the agency pushed this whole open adoption thing. I figured it was just talk and I'd never hear from them again after the papers were signed. But 8 years later, I get photos every 3 months plus actual visits twice a year. Her adoptive mom even calls me to chat about school stuff. Has anyone else had their first adoption plan actually work out the way it was promised?
